Preliminary rounds go to Texas, UNF

North Florida to host first NCAA track and field championship
Last Updated - August 16, 2011 10:02 GMT

INDIANAPOLIS -- The NCAA Division I Men's and Women's Track and Field Committee has selected Jacksonville, Fla., and Austin, Texas, as host sites for the 2012 NCAA Division I Track and Field East and West preliminary rounds, respectively. The competition dates for both sites are May 24-26.

The University of North Florida will play host the East preliminary round competition at Hodges Stadium. North Florida will serve as track and field hosts for the first time in NCAA championship history. Texas will play host the West preliminary round competition at Mike A. Myers Track & Soccer Stadium, where it has hosted numerous NCAA track and field competitions, most recently for the 2010 NCAA West preliminary round. It was also the site of the 2004 national championships.

“We received an increased number of quality bids by institutions and sports commissions,” said Todd Patulski, chair of the NCAA Division I Men’s and Women’s Track and Field Committee and deputy athletics director at Baylor. “This is a significant event that brings a lot of track student-athletes, coaches and fans to a campus and community. Texas and North Florida are two of those quality sites that will provide first-class facilities, staff and a commitment to the event. We’re confident this will be a tremendous year for the student-athletes, coaches and everyone involved.”
